Improved Tree Health
Ongoing tree maintenance significantly improves the total health of trees, promoting their longevity and resilience against illnesses and pests. Regular pruning eliminates dead or diseased branches, allowing trees to allocate resources more efficiently. This practice also increases air circulation and sunlight exposure, promoting robust growth. Routine inspections by professionals can detect potential concerns early, such as infestations or nutrient deficiencies, enabling timely intervention. Moreover, proper watering and mulching techniques promote root development and soil health, further reinforcing the tree's immune system. By investing in regular tree care, property owners can confirm their trees remain vibrant and strong, effectively reducing the likelihood of severe health problems that could lead to pricey removals or replacements in the future.

Important Examinations and Care Solutions for Tree Condition
Preserving tree health demands meticulous assessments and focused treatments, as even minor issues can develop into major problems if left unaddressed. Professional arborists conduct comprehensive evaluations to detect signs of disease, pest infestations, or nutrient deficiencies. These assessments frequently involve evaluating bark, leaves, and root systems to establish the overall vitality of the tree.
When issues are discovered, proper treatments are put into action. This may encompass the application of fertilizers to address nutrient deficiencies, fungicides to eliminate diseases, or insecticides to control pests. In some cases, more advanced techniques such as soil aeration or root zone management are utilized to promote healthier growth.
Consistent monitoring and follow-up assessments ensure that treatments are effective and that the tree continues to thrive. By focusing on these critical evaluations and interventions, tree owners can notably enhance the longevity and resilience of their landscape's arboreal assets.

Symptoms of Disease
A healthy landscape relies on the vigor of its trees, making it important to recognize the symptoms of disease that may suggest the need for removal. Tree owners should be vigilant for indicators such as yellowing or drooping leaves, which may indicate underlying health concerns. Additionally, unusual growths like fungi or cankers on the bark can suggest infections that compromise the structural stability. The presence of pests, such as borers or scales, often brings about significant deterioration if left untreated. Sudden leaf drop or dieback in branches can further indicate severe stress or illness. If multiple indicators appear, it may be time to consult a professional arborist to assess the situation and determine whether removal is the most prudent course of action.
Structural Instability Concerns
While assessing the health of a landscape, structural instability in trees can create significant risks that may justify removal. Symptoms of instability include visible lean, extensive root damage, or trunk cracks, which can compromise the tree's ability to withstand environmental stresses. If a tree displays a significant lean towards structures or high-traffic areas, the risk of failure grows, especially during storms or high winds. Additionally, trees with hollow trunks or extensive decay may not support their weight adequately, further raising the hazard. Homeowners and property managers should evaluate these factors carefully, as failing to address structural instability can cause property damage or personal injury. Seeking advice from a certified arborist can provide essential insights into whether removal is the safest option.

Readying Your Landscape for Seasonal Changes With Professional Care
As the seasons shift, landscape preparation for upcoming changes becomes crucial for keeping it healthy and attractive. Professional tree services play a vital role in this preparation, delivering expert care customized to regional weather patterns. In autumn, for instance, these experts can conduct tree pruning to remove dead or damaged branches, reducing hazards during winter storms. They also recommend mulching to protect roots from freezing temperatures and to maintain ground hydration.
In spring, professional services include reviewing tree health, spotting pests, and providing treatments to support growth. Additionally, they can guide homeowners on the most suitable planting times for seasonal flowers and shrubs.

What Certifications Should Tree Service Professionals Have?
Tree care experts should have certifications including ISA Arborist Certification, TCIA Accreditation, and locally mandated licenses. Such qualifications reflect proficiency in tree care, safety practices, and alignment with industry standards, guaranteeing dependable and expert service.
